Montrichardia linifera, also known under the common name aninga, is a tropical plant native to South America.
[4] The aquatic species is a helophyte and can grow up to seven meters in height.
[5] The plant often grows in monospecific stands and thickes along rivers, lakes and other wetlands.
M. linifera can be differentiated from the similar M. arborescens by several characteristics, including having a spathe tube that is greenish-white internally and a spathe blade that is yellowish externally, while M. arborescens has a spathe-tube that is reddish internally and a spathe-blade that is green externally.
